Hays leads Pitman to win
Dan Hays secured a three-set win at second singles, helping Pitman defeat Pennsville, 3-2, in the NJSIAA South Jersey Group 1 boys' tennis championship on Tuesday at Gateway.

Hays edged Bryan Bodine, 6-3, 1-6, 6-1, and the Panthers (19-2) also got wins from Eric Todd at third singles, and Jon Sjolander and Torey Langlois at first doubles.

South Jersey Group 2. Ty Simcox and Luke Grabiak outlasted Middle Township's Andrew Sellers and Anthony DiCicco, 6-1, 1-6, 6-0, at first doubles, highlighting Haddonfield's 4-1 title win at Millville.
The Bulldogs (28-4) also got singles wins from Brian Oatway and Matt Godlewski.

South Jersey Group 3. By sweeping the doubles matches, Moorestown captured another sectional title, edging Ocean City, 3-2, in the final at Vineland.
Matt Holzinger and Mike Schwartz won at first doubles, Colin Groundwater and Justin Wisniewski cruised at second doubles, and the Quakers added Michael Bass' 6-0, 6-0 shutout at third singles.

South Jersey Non-Public A. Chaz Berenato prevailed at first singles, but it was the only match St. Augustine (19-3) won in a 4-1 championship loss to Christian Brothers (18-3) at Southern Regional.

South Jersey Non-Public B. Moorestown Friends (14-5) successfully defended its title by edging Sacred Heart (12-7), 3-2, at Atkinson Park in Sewell. Luke Timber and Jake Brown provided a key point with a 6-2, 6-2 triumph at second doubles.
